"Mindful parenting is the hardest job on the planet, but it's also one that has the potential for the deepest kind of satisfaction... and the greatest feelings of interconnectedness and community and belonging." By  Jon Kabat- Zinn.

Mindfulness is seeing things more clearly and paying attention moment to moment.  It is the basis for understanding our thoughts, our emotions and our fears.  Mindfulness helps us to take a pause and look at a difficult situation with a new sense of focus.  When we can see clearly, we are better able to direct our choices with more wisdom , attention and compassion.


The best gift we can give to our children is to become better parents.   In our ability to become mindful,we can gain greater insight into who and what we are.  We  are constantly preoccupied with the past or the future and rarely concentrate on the present.  Children live what they learn .  Let them notice your presence and they will follow suit.
